IF FDA / USDA / SUBJECT-to government agencies, CBP will release the shipment, but there is still FDA hold on it. You could pick-up your shipment, but can NOT be sold or altered until FDA hold is lifted. . FDA may visit location of shipment or email/mail/call the consignee send notification when you could use or sell or if the shipment must be returned to your vendor (normally it could take 4 weeks from . FDA/US Customs) OR FDA MAY NOTIFY THAT IT MUST BE DESTROYED, (click here) for sample of notification. IF so, Fees will applied: Customs destruction forms = +$200 + Messenger Fee = +$50 . + FDA fees = +$150 + Solid Waste Fee +$300 + Storage (if any) + Pickup and Delivery of shipment to Waste (if any) + Lab Test (if any) + ETC..... (all fees MUST be pre-pay by consignee/importer) . In other case: . FDA Released after Detention, months later with Notice of: These products are released. This notice does not constitute assurance that the product released complies with all provisions of the .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act, or other related Acts, and does not preclude action should the product later be found violative. (click here) sample. . (click here) for samples NOTE: IF you are buying from Two different factory/suppliers, you could consolidate the shipment under one BL, but you can NOT consolidate under one invoice/packing-list. It MUST be submitted as 2 different invoice/factory/supplier to US Customs. Each Bill-of-Lading(B/L) is considered as one shipment & it must be cleared as each BL by US Customs/us.
